A cube has a volume of 64 cubic inches. What is the length of one side of the cube?

Correct: C

The formula for the volume of a cube is V = s^3, where V is the volume and s is the length of one side. Given the volume is 64 cubic inches, we solve for s: s^3 = 64. Taking the cube root of both sides, we find s = 4.
